Recognizing the symptoms of heart disease
Coronary heart attack is the number one killer in the world. For that we must be alert and able to recognize early symptoms in advance can lead to heart attacks. The following are symptoms of a heart disease.
If there is pain in the chest, then the first thing we should do is stop all work no matter what we do, and then lay down and breathe deeply. Trying to stay calm, be it for people who suffer heart attacks or those who try to help. The panic would likely trigger the possibility of arrhythmias or heart rhythm irregularities, that would threaten life cause heart attacks will become more severe.
Symptoms are felt by a person suffering from coronary heart disease include pain or pain in the chest, where most people thought that it was just sore because of indigestion. Other symptoms are feeling depressed in the middle of the chest for 30 seconds to 5 minutes. Then the other symptom is a cold sweat, heart palpitations, dizziness and feel like going to faint. Such symptoms are often ignored by the patient.
For several months before a heart attack, usually sufferers often feel very tired. Do not assume these symptoms are caused by lack of sleep or stress due to work.
Pain or pressure in the chest feeling, gave warning to half of those who suffer from heart disease. Some people have difficulty breathing or fatigue and feeling weak as the symptoms. This happens because the heart is not getting enough oxygen due to coronary blockage.
